摘要
We have successfully grown single crystals of a novel ytterbium-based layered compound Yb4RuGe8 and studied its structural, magnetic, thermal, and transport properties. The magnetic susceptibility has a broad peak caused by the Kondo effect at approximately 40 K and is enhanced below 15 K owing to the development of additional magnetic correlations. An analysis with the grand-Kadowaki-Woods relation reveals that the low-temperature state except for the effect of the additional magnetic correlations is a heavy-mass Fermi liquid.
